Shareholder dissent continued and at this year’s AGM on 28 Aug 2019, 3 directors were voted out, Sir Robin Miller, Lord Flight and David Glick and various other motions were defeated.
Proxy votes cast were as follows:
Resolution | For | Against | Withheld | |
---|---|---|---|---|
2. | Approve directors’ remuneration report | 1,770,628 | 3,106,545 | 47,968 |
3. | Re-elect Sir Robin Miller | 1,725,784 | 3,140,268 | 59,089 |
4. | Re-elect Lord Flight | 1,659,996 | 3,206,056 | 59,089 |
5. | Re-elect David Glick | 1,715,071 | 3,183,421 | 26,649 |
6. | Re-appoint Grant Thornton UK LLP as auditor | 2,147,140 | 2,751,352 | 26,649 |
8. | Authorise directors to allot shares | 1,960,585 | 2,938,060 | 26,496 |
9. | Authorise directors to allot shares with disregard to pre-emption rights | 1,737,431 | 3,118,075 | 69,635 |
That leaves only one director Terry Back, who sits on the board of Edge Performance VCT. He is the founder and a former partner of Grant Thornton’s Media & Entertainment practice and has over 40 years of advisory experience, specialising in independent television companies. Terry is a non-executive director of a number of private companies and served on the non-executive boards of both Grant Thornton UK and Grant Thornton International.
